Copier coller special formules comme valeurs

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

teodormircea

XLDnaute Occasionnel
Bonjour le forum

Il y a t-il une possibilité d'utiliser une macros qui copie et colle les cellules qui contient des formules comme valeurs. Le truc c'est qu'il me faut une solution pour pouvoir faire cela sur des cellules filtres.😀
 
Re : Copier coller special formules comme valeurs

Code:
Sub PAST_VALUE_SPECIAL()
Selection.Copy
    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ks:=False, Transpose:=False
   
End Sub
jai enregistre ce code mais ca ne fonctionne pas sur des cellules filtres
 
Re : Copier coller special formules comme valeurs

Voila une solution qui marche sur les zones selecte

Code:
Sub PASTE_SPECIAL_VALUES_TEXTMODE()

Dim oneArea As Range
 With Selection
On Error Resume Next
With Selection.SpecialCells(xlCellTypeVisible)
    With .SpecialCells(xlCellTypeFormulas, xlTextValues)
        .NumberFormat = "@"
    End With
    For Each oneArea In .SpecialCells(xlCellTypeFormulas).Areas
        oneArea.Value = oneArea.Value
    Next oneArea
End With
End With
On Error GoTo 0
End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
12
Affichages
364
Retour